On Mar 31, 2007, at 12:19, Ron wrote: Subject says it all. Doing a source compile under Debian or Debian- like condition is not an option for the end user. They need an apt- get (the ubuntu equivalent to rpm AFAICT) version. Ubuntu has 8.2.3 in the upcoming Feisty distribution; in the meantime, you can install it on Edgy from the edgy-backports tree: http://packages.ubuntu.com/cgi-bin//search_packages.pl? version=all&subword=1&exact=&arch=any&releases=all&case=insensitive&keyw ords=postgresql-8.2&searchon=names This requires adding a source line to /etc/apt/sources.list that references this repository. This should suffice: deb http://gb.archive.ubuntu.com/ubuntu/ edgy-backports main restricted universe deb-src http://gb.archive.ubuntu.com/ubuntu/ edgy-backports main restricted universe (You might want to substitute your country code for "gb" in the URLs.)
